    Different programs using different sound card

    Apparently different programs like to use different sound cards for audio, either the pci card or the on board card. Here is a list of some programs and what card they use:
    On board
    -vlc
    -rhythm box
    -pidgin
    -post login sound
    PCI
    -firefox
    -hydrogen
    -ubuntu sounds (pre-login drums, hardware testing, so far i have found)
    Is there a way to make a program use a certain sound card? It is quite annoying when I have to switch what my speakers are hooked up to frequently.

    Re: Different programs using different sound card

    If you disable your onboard sound card in the BIOS you won't have this problem.
